Su Xiaoqi, an orphan girl who sells tofu on the street, accidentally replaces Princess Zhaoyang of Jingguo and goes to Yongguo to get married.
On the wedding night, she was exposed by her husband Ling Shuo on the spot.
Ling Shuo did not disclose the identity of the fake princess to the public, but instead silently covered up her flaws and eliminated the risk of her identity being exposed.
One carries a blood feud and pursues the unjust case of his grandfather;
One is walking on thin ice with a false identity.
Ling Shuo hated the shackles of imperial power throughout his life.
He blamed the emperor for imprisoning his biological mother, causing her to die in depression.
But when the power was in his hands, he made the same mistake again and forcibly trapped Su Xiaoqi in the palace.
The tenderness we had together in the past gradually shattered, trust collapsed, and we gradually drifted away.
How should he choose between the supreme power and the sweetheart he can't let go of?
